From Bayeux, miraculously spared from the massive bombings of World War II, you ride to Port-en-Bessin and the main D-Day landing beaches. Under the allies’ flags still floating everywhere, discover a region forever marked by the events of June 1944.
Omaha beach, Juno beach, Gold beach, Sword beach, Utah Beach. They witnessed the arrival of thousands of young soldiers from the American, English, French, Polish allied forces. They hold a piece of history and all have something to tell about that day.
Stop in some of the museums you come across on the itinerary. They will help you visualize the forces in place at the time, the equipment used and geographical surface covered on the D-Day landing.
The American military cemetery in Colleville-sur-Mer a site of emotional power and strange beauty, which pays a tribute to those who enabled the return of freedom
In Bayeux you connect to a part of medieval history which you can enjoy thanks to one of the oldest and longest tapestries in the world. It tells the story of the conquest of England by William the Conqueror in 1066.

From BAYEUX to PORT EN BESSIN HUPPAIN 56km 398m
You leave Bayeux onto small roads through the Norman grove. Immersed in bucolic countryside landscapes, it feels like the holidays. A few kilometers away, you reach the Canadian site of Juno Beach. Later on the day, you catch sight of the ocean. It seems to be tainted with big strange blocks of concrete. Get closer to have a better look. You are in front of Winston Harbor. The concrete blocks make the artificial port of Arromanches, which allowed the routing of men and refueling during the Allied landing of 1944. The itinerary then takes you to the charming village of Port-en-Bessin.
FROM PORT EN BESSIN, OMAHA BEACH LOOP 37km 188m
Port-en-Bessin is a charming little port. It has a soft atmosphere to it with the pleasant rhythm of fishermen and sailors entering and exit the port and everyday life in of small town. You ride along the Côte de Nacre toward Omaha Beach. You can make a halt at the American cemetery in Colleville-sur-Mer. This site, full of history helps to better understand the importance of human losses and the horror of war. Yet it also testifies to an impressive strength, and a certain beauty.
- For a few more km 50km 239m
Extend your route to the Pointe du Hoc, a site steeped in history that can testify to the difficulty of the landing and the importance of human losses.

End of stay after breakfast. Before you leave enjoy a visit to the Bayeux tapestry museum. It displays a major and amazingly preserved 11th century work of art, a 70 meters (230 feet) long tapestry relating the conquest of England by William the Conqueror!
